    Williamsport is an old city with many wonderful examples of...

    Williamsport is an old city with many wonderful examples of 1900s architecture. There is a section called Millionaire's Row that also houses restaurants and attractions besides living quarters. Quite beautiful! There is quite a variety of things to do from the Little League Hall of Fame to museums to fishing and hiking. You won't be bored! The downtown has some interesting bars and restaurants as well. The traffic is nominal and most people are courteous. The hotel location near Wegmans grocery store and some downtown retail shops and conference centers is ideal.
